Who created the Magic School Bus?

The Magic School Bus / Joanna Cole began writing the Magic School Bus series in 1986, along with illustrator Bruce Degen.

Where did the magic school bus come from?

The Magic School Bus is somewhat based on a 1970s Ward International school bus with fender skirts on the rear wheels, and the front windshield being 2 different windows. Its overhead sign shows a “message” depending on the language, such as “WAHOO” or “BLAST OFF” in English, very similar to electronic “welcome” signs.

Why isn’t Phoebe in the Magic School Bus Rides Again?

At least most of the characters from the original show return, despite the fact that they look completely different. Despite the removal of Phoebe, there is a valid explanation as to why she is absent from the series. Reason being that Phoebe went back to her old school, which is why she is replaced by Jyoti.

Is Liz from Magic School Bus a boy or girl?

Liz is an anthropomorphic Jackson’s chameleon with blue eyes and striped horns. She is mostly light green with a dark green belly. Her back and tail are lined with spiked protrusions.

What does the Magic School Bus teach?

Scholastic has developed resources based on the episodes for teachers to take students on their own adventures into space, history, the human body, and more. The Netflix revival hopes to delight a new generation of children and to help students find the magic in the exploration and discovery of science and technology.
